    Everything tasted great and really reasonable prices.

    The place is clean and the size of the bakery is good. It's not that big but there's some seating area. The pastry selection is a good but there were a lot of duplicates, so it's not huge of a selection as it appears because many of the rows had the same item. I bought 11 different pastries/breads the total was a little over $30, which is a great price. They do charge for a paper bag and only the items with meat in them are taxed. All the bread on the pastries were nice and soft and the amount of fillings to bread was the perfect amount. I like the self service aspect of these types of places, so I can take my time looking at all the different options without the pressure of trying to make up my mind of what to get. There wasn't much wait to check out and pay for the pastries too. Samara packed the items neatly and fast.

    We love stopping by here whenever we're at Serramonte for some baked goods or a drink pick me up. They have some classic Chinese baked goods, a variety of cakes and some unique flavors of breads and pastries. They also have some great drink flavors and tasty toppings like their boba. Mango Coconut Smoothie - One of their new summer mango drinks. It is a balanced, sweet blend of mango smoothie and coconut milk. There is a good amount of toppings as well with mango chunks and jellies which add freshness and textures. My friend tried the lychee milk tea which had a nice lychee flavor and chewy boba. A delicious place to stop by if you're at the mall.
